Woman Pulled Gun, Released Pit Bull In Armed Confrontation, Groton Police Say (patch.com) — Residents in Groton are learning more about a tense weekend confrontation on Poquonnock Road, where police say a woman blocked another car, released a large pit bull, and pointed a handgun while making threats. Officers later arrested 30-year-old Groton resident Latazia Wheeler at her home, seizing a handgun and charging her with multiple offenses, including first-degree threatening with a firearm and assault on a public safety officer.

See How Groton's Test Scores Compare Amid National Reading Decline (patch.com) — Families in Groton can see how local students are faring in the wake of a national reading slump, with district test scores now slightly below the U.S. average. The analysis shows Groton students’ scores and learning rates have declined over time, mirroring broader post-pandemic challenges while highlighting reforms elsewhere that may offer ideas for improvement.

EB seeking approval for first conversion projects at former Crystal Mall (theday.com) — Electric Boat’s plan to convert parts of the former Crystal Mall into training and office space in Waterford is designed to free up room at its space-constrained Groton shipyard so it can focus more on submarine construction. The project could eventually bring up to 5,000 workers to the Route 85 site, with major traffic changes and extensive training facilities planned starting in 2027.
